2026 Subaru Forester Buyer's Guide: Why It Continues to Be One of America's Favorite Compact SUVs The 2026 Subaru Forester is a compact SUV designed for drivers who want confidence in every season, excellent visibility, advanced safety technology and standard Symmetrical All-Wheel Drive. Available in multiple trim levels, the Forester combines everyday practicality with Subaru's legendary capability, making it an excellent choice for commuters, families and outdoor enthusiasts alike. Why Buy the 2026 Subaru Forester? The Forester stands out because every model includes features many competitors reserve for higher trim levels. Subaru's legendary Symmetrical All-Wheel Drive comes standard, providing added confidence during rain, snow and changing road conditions. Combined with generous ground clearance and the SUBARU BOXER® engine, the Forester delivers a smooth ride both on pavement and on unpaved roads. Highlights of the 2026 Subaru Forester include: Standard Symmetrical All-Wheel Drive SUBARU BOXER® engine EyeSight® Driver Assist Technology Large touchscreen multimedia system Wireless Apple CarPlay® compatibility Wireless Android Auto™ compatibility Comfortable seating for five passengers Flexible cargo space for everyday errands and weekend adventures Safety remains one of the Forester's strongest selling points. Subaru's latest EyeSight® Driver Assist Technology helps monitor traffic, assist with steering and braking when necessary, and provides additional peace of mind during daily driving. Screenshot The 2026 Subaru Ascent is Subaru's largest SUV, offering seating for up to eight passengers, standard Symmetrical All-Wheel Drive, advanced EyeSight® Driver Assist Technology and multiple trim levels designed for growing families. If you need generous passenger space, impressive all-weather capability and modern technology, the Ascent remains one of the most capable family SUVs in its class. The Ascent is designed for drivers who need more passenger room without sacrificing capability. Every model includes Subaru's legendary Symmetrical All-Wheel Drive, generous ground clearance and a turbocharged SUBARU BOXER® engine for confident everyday performance. Standard Symmetrical All-Wheel Drive Turbocharged SUBARU BOXER® engine Seating for up to eight passengers EyeSight® Driver Assist Technology Large touchscreen infotainment system Wireless Apple CarPlay® and Android Auto™ compatibility 2026 Subaru Ascent Trim Levels Trim Highlights Premium Excellent value with advanced safety and family-friendly technology Limited Leather-appointed interior, additional comfort and convenience features Touring Premium luxury amenities and advanced technology Onyx Edition Touring Distinctive styling with upscale appointments and rugged character Which 2026 Subaru Ascent Trim Is Best? The Premium trim offers outstanding value for many families. It combines standard all-wheel drive, advanced safety systems and modern connectivity while keeping ownership affordable. Best for Value The Premium trim is ideal for families wanting capability, safety and comfort without moving into luxury pricing. Best for Comfort The Limited trim adds premium materials, upgraded seating and additional convenience features for daily commuting and road trips. Best for Luxury The Touring and Onyx Edition Touring models include the highest level of refinement with premium interior materials, advanced technology and distinctive styling. Is the Subaru Ascent Good for Families? Yes. The Subaru Ascent was designed specifically for larger families. Flexible seating configurations, generous cargo space and numerous USB charging ports make it practical for school, vacations and weekend adventures. What Safety Features Come Standard? Every 2026 Subaru Ascent includes EyeSight® Driver Assist Technology, along with numerous active safety features that help drivers remain aware of changing traffic conditions. 2026 Subaru Outback Buyer's Guide: Which Trim Is Right for You? The redesigned 2026 Subaru Outback starts at a manufacturer-published MSRP of $34,995. Available in Premium, Limited, Limited XT, Wilderness, Touring and Touring XT trims, every model comes standard with Symmetrical All-Wheel Drive. The best trim depends on whether your priorities are everyday value, luxury, turbocharged performance or maximum off-road capability. What's New for the 2026 Subaru Outback? The seventh-generation 2026 Subaru Outback receives one of the biggest redesigns in the model's history. The newest generation features a bolder SUV-inspired design, an upgraded interior, improved technology and enhanced safety while maintaining the legendary capability Outback owners expect. Subaru also introduces a standard 12.1-inch touchscreen, a 12.3-inch fully digital instrument cluster and upgraded EyeSight Driver Assist Technology across the lineup. 2026 Subaru Outback Trim Levels & Starting MSRP Trim Starting MSRP Premium $34,995 Limited $41,715 Limited XT $44,365 Wilderness $44,995 Touring $45,395 Touring XT $47,995 Which 2026 Subaru Outback Trim Offers the Best Value? For many buyers, the Premium trim delivers the strongest overall value. It combines Subaru's legendary capability with an extensive list of standard technology and safety features while offering the lowest starting MSRP in the lineup. Premium Standard Symmetrical All-Wheel Drive 12.1-inch Subaru Multimedia touchscreen 12.3-inch digital gauge cluster EyeSight Driver Assist Technology Power rear gate Limited The Limited trim adds upscale comfort with leather-trimmed upholstery, additional premium amenities and convenience features for families and commuters. Limited XT The Limited XT upgrades performance with Subaru's turbocharged 2.4-liter BOXER engine, making it an excellent choice for drivers wanting stronger acceleration while maintaining everyday comfort. Wilderness The Outback Wilderness is designed for drivers who frequently venture off pavement. It features increased ground clearance, rugged styling and additional off-road capability. Touring & Touring XT The Touring models represent the top of the lineup with premium interior appointments, advanced technology and available turbocharged performance in the Touring XT. Which Engine Should You Choose? Most Outback trims feature Subaru's naturally aspirated 2.5-liter SUBARU BOXER engine, while the Limited XT, Wilderness and Touring XT receive the more powerful turbocharged 2.4-liter SUBARU BOXER engine for additional horsepower and stronger towing capability. Does Every 2026 Subaru Outback Include All-Wheel Drive? Yes. Every 2026 Subaru Outback comes standard with Subaru Symmetrical All-Wheel Drive, providing confident traction during rain, snow and changing Michigan weather conditions. How Safe Is the 2026 Subaru Outback? Safety continues to be one of the Outback's biggest strengths. Every model includes the latest generation of Subaru EyeSight Driver Assist Technology along with numerous active safety systems designed to help drivers remain aware of surrounding traffic.
